
No Country for Old Men is a gripping crime thriller that masterfully blends elements of Western and suspense genres, spotlighting a tense cat-and-mouse chase involving a relentless killer and a principled sheriff. This film's chilling atmosphere and moral complexity have made it a modern classic, captivating audiences with its brutal realism and philosophical depth.

No Country for Old Men marked a significant cultural moment by redefining the Western and thriller genres with its stark realism and portrayal of violence and fate. Adapted from Cormac McCarthy's novel, the film explores themes of mortality and the shifting nature of justice in contemporary society, resonating deeply with audiences and critics alike.
The plot revolves around Llewelyn Moss, who discovers a drug deal gone wrong in the Texas desert, finding a satchel with $2 million. His decision to take the money sets off a relentless pursuit by Anton Chigurh, a chilling hitman whose presence symbolizes unstoppable fate. Meanwhile, Sheriff Ed Tom Bell grapples with the escalating violence, embodying the moral conscience of the story.
Critically acclaimed for its direction by Joel and Ethan Coen, No Country for Old Men received praise for its tight screenplay, suspenseful pacing, and outstanding performances, particularly from Javier Bardem as Chigurh. The film won multiple Academy Awards, including Best Picture and Best Supporting Actor, solidifying its status in film history.
Its legacy is profound, influencing countless filmmakers and continuing to be studied for its thematic depth and minimalist storytelling approach. The film’s depiction of violence and its existential undertones challenge viewers to reflect on the nature of evil and justice in a world that seems increasingly chaotic and unforgiving.
